James Richard Thomas, Sr., 90, of Florence, SC, passed away on Monday, December 28, 2015. Mr. Thomas was born in Olanta, SC, a son of the late Francis Clyde Thomas and Frances Emma Chandler.He was a veteran of the US Navy Air Corp and served during World War II.Mr. Thomas was the owner and operator of Thomas Steel Erection.He was a member of the Gideons and Commander of the Effingham Legion Post 160 for a number of years.Mr. Thomas was a member, former deacon and Sunday School teacher at First Free Will Baptist Church.
